Abstract
The utility model provides a monodentate agitator, including bracket, link mechanism, lift cylinder, crossbeam and ripping teeth, link mechanism is articulated with bracket and crossbeam respectively, and wherein, ripping teeth includes toothholder, ratch and prong, and the toothholder setting is on the crossbeam, be provided with the slot on the toothholder, the ratch pegs graft in the slot, all be provided with the degree of depth and transfer knothole on the cell wall of slot and the ratch body of rod, ratch and slot are through the round pin hub connection, the prong passes through the round pin hub connection with the ratch. The utility model discloses an adjustable of the degree of depth through the round pin hub connection, through the upper and lower position change of the upper and lower position drive prong of control rack in the toothholder slot, is realized loosening the soil respectively by prong, ratch and toothholder. And prong and ratch components of a whole that can function independently set up, when making ripping teeth take place to damage, only change the prong can, the cost is practiced thrift in convenient operation.
Description
Technical field
The utility model is related to a kind of ridge buster, specifically a kind of monodentate ridge buster.
Background technology
Ridge buster is a kind of conventional engineering machinery annex, is typically hung from the engineering machinery afterbody such as bull-dozer, land leveller,
It is mainly used in the pre- loose operation to working face.For bull-dozer is particularly earth mover, ridge buster can be used not only for
Clay, the soil layer such as frozen soil of hardening it is loose, it may also be used for the hard operation such as rock that gravel, hardened salt mine, layer haircut reach
The stripping in face.Because its low production cost, efficiency high, security are good, user has been obtained the advantages of can partly substitute drillhole blasting
Favorable comment, therefore be a kind of using increasingly extensive equipment.
In use, tine is moved up and down under the ordering about of lift cylinder and linkage, but existing tine
Ratch length fix, pine soil depth is non-adjustable;Crown is welded and fixed with ratch, is difficult to change after damage;Lift cylinder quantity
It is few, make ridge buster overall structure unstable.
Utility model content
The purpose of this utility model is to provide a kind of monodentate ridge buster, with solve existing ridge buster pine soil depth it is non-adjustable,
The not easily changeable problem of tine.
What the utility model was realized in:A kind of monodentate ridge buster, including bracket, linkage, lift cylinder, crossbeam
And tine;The linkage is hinged respectively with the bracket and the crossbeam, wherein,
The tine includes toothholder, ratch and crown, and the toothholder is arranged on the crossbeam;
Slot is provided with the toothholder, the ratch grafting enters in the slot;Cell wall and institute in the slot
State and depth adjustment hole is provided with the ratch body of rod, the ratch is connected with the slot by bearing pin;The crown with it is described
Ratch is connected by bearing pin.
The linkage includes upper connecting rod and lower link, and the upper connecting rod is hinged with the upper end of the bracket, it is described under
Connecting rod is hinged with the lower end of the bracket, and the other end of the upper connecting rod, lower link is provided with connecting plate, the upper connecting rod and
The lower link is hinged respectively with the upper and lower ends of the connecting plate;The beam erection is on the connecting plate.
The rear bracket part is provided with suspension plate, the suspension plate is connected with engineering machinery.
The quantity of the linkage is two, and linkage described in two is arranged on parallel in the suspension plate;In the same manner, institute
Connecting plate quantity is stated for two, the beam erection is described in two between connecting plate.
The quantity of the lift cylinder is two, is separately positioned on per group of linkage;Wherein, carry described in each
The two ends of oil-lifting jar are hinged respectively with the corresponding bracket and the connecting plate.
Using above-mentioned technical proposal, the utility model can be connected by bracket or suspension plate with engineering machinery, with even
Linkage connects tine, and lift cylinder is used for fluctuating for tine.Bracket of the present utility model, linkage, lifting
Oil cylinder could be arranged to left and right form in pairs, increased the stability of tine.
Crown of the present utility model, ratch and toothholder are connected respectively by bearing pin, by regulation ratch in toothholder slot
Upper-lower position drive crown upper-lower position change, realize the adjustable of pine soil depth.And crown and ratch split are arranged, and are made
When tine is damaged, crown is only changed, convenient operation is cost-effective.Tine of the present utility model is monodentate knot
Structure, can bear bigger power, can be in harder ground handling.

The present embodiment be in the form of two groups of linkages, in practical application, linkage quantity of the present utility model
Can be set to according to installing space one or more groups of, multigroup linkage can improve the stability of tine.
As shown in figure 1, the utility model includes bracket 1, linkage 2, lift cylinder 3 and crossbeam 4.Bracket 1 can be direct
In the frame of engineering machinery, in order to easy for installation, bracket 1 can be arranged in suspension plate 5, suspension plate 5 again with engineering
The frame connection of machinery.
Tine of the present utility model is arranged on crossbeam 4, and tine includes toothholder 6, ratch 7 and crown 8, and toothholder 6 is pacified
It is mounted on crossbeam 4, slot 9 is provided with toothholder 6, in the insertion slot 9 of ratch 7.Depth is provided with toothholder 6 and ratch 7
Degree adjustment hole 10, ratch 7 can be moved up and down after insertion toothholder 6 in slot, adjusted to suitable position, using bearing pin
Ratch 7 and toothholder 6 are linked together.Crown of the present utility model 8 is arranged on the lower end of ratch 7, in the same manner, crown 8 and ratch 7
Connected by bearing pin.Tine of the present utility model can as needed adjust upper-lower position, it is ensured that pine soil depth during operation.Separately
Outward, because crown weares and teares most fast in operation, so crown of the present utility model 8 is set to Split type structure with ratch 7, producing
After abrasion, crown 8 is individually replaced, it is easy to operate, it is cost-effective.
As shown in Fig. 2 linkage of the present utility model 2 include upper connecting rod 2.1, lower link 2.2, upper connecting rod 2.1 and under
One end of connecting rod 2.2 is hinged respectively with the upper and lower ends of bracket 1, and the other end is provided with connecting plate 2.3, upper connecting rod 2.1 and lower company
The other end of bar 2.2 is hinged with connecting plate 2.3, and the two ends of lift cylinder 3 are hinged and the company of driving respectively with bracket 1, connecting plate 2.3
Linkage is up and down.Crossbeam 4 is arranged on connecting plate 2.3.
